  Commuter Savings Program (CSP)  

diagonal image

The Commuter Savings Program (CSP) is an optional benefit that gives eligible employees the opportunity to use tax-free dollars to pay out-of-pocket, work-related commuting and/or parking expenses. This benefit allows employees to lower their taxable income and increase disposable income. There is no specific enrollment period; State employees may enroll, cancel or change deductions at any time.

Full-time and part-time employees (working 50% or greater) who have payroll checks processed through the Office of the Comptroller may enroll in CSP at any time. Deductions are made before federal, state and social security taxes are withheld.

Eligible employees may elect a monthly pre-tax deduction up to:

  • $230 for bus or train transit passes or vanpooling expenses incurred for work-related commuting costs. The transit media selected is conveniently mailed directly to the participants home before the beginning of the month.
  • $230 for work-related parking expenses. The parking provider may be paid directly, or the participant may be reimbursed by submitting a claim form and proof of services to the CSP Plan Administrator.

Benefits for selections made by the 10th of any month will be effective the following month. Payroll deductions will coincide with the first pay period of the benefit month. For example, a selection made on or before February 10th would begin in March; therefore, the first payroll deduction would be taken from the March 1st 15th pay period for a semi-monthly employee.

In order to enroll in the Commuter Savings Program you must first register online with the plan administrator (Note: If you had previously registered on the FBMC website to view an FSA account, you do not need to register again).

To REGISTER: Go to www.myFBMC.com. Click on 'Click here to register a new account' and complete the required fields. Once the registration process is complete, the various tabs will be enabled for viewing.

To ENROLL: Click on ‘Accounts,’ then ‘My CSP,’ then ‘Orders’. You will need to enter your email address the first time you login. Click on either the ‘Transit Order’ or ‘Parking Order’ tab and follow the prompts to enroll in the desired benefit.

To CHANGE or CANCEL: Login to www.myFBMC.com and click on ‘Accounts,’ then ‘My CSP,’ then ‘Orders.’ Click on either the ‘Transit Order’ or ‘Parking Order’ tab to change or cancel the deduction. Remember, all changes and cancellations must be completed by midnight on the 10th of the month in order to take effect the 1st day of the following month.

For help with enrollment or changing/canceling a benefit, please call FBMC toll-free at 1-800-342-8017, Monday - Friday 7 a.m. – 10 p.m. Eastern Time.
